Instagram remains a fantastic platform for visual storytelling, allowing for creative use of photos and reels to engage followers. Starting out on YouTube can be a bit daunting at first, but with consistent content and understanding your audience, it becomes a powerful tool for building community. Over time, I've noticed that integrating multiple socials such as Facebook and Twitter alongside Instagram increases your visibility and allows you to engage different demographics. Facebook groups and pages enable direct community building, while Twitter’s real-time conversations offer a way to join trending discussions and connect personally. Tips that helped me include focusing on quality over quantity, using relevant hashtags strategically to gain discoverability, and engaging actively with your audience by responding to comments and messages. Platforms like YouTube require patience as growth can be slow initially, but collaborating with other creators and optimizing video titles and descriptions for SEO makes a significant difference. Overall, diversifying your social presence and committing to creating authentic, relatable content across Instagram, YouTube, Facebook, and Twitter has helped me grow a loyal following that supports and inspires my creative journey.
